Prep time: 15 mins
Cook time: 9 mins
Total time: 24 mins
Yields: 48 Cookies
Serve with milk or warm under vanilla ice cream.
Ingredients
- 2 sticks Butter, softened
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 3/4 cup light brown sugar
- 2 eggs
- 1 tsp vanilla
- 1 cup flour
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 3 cups Oatmeal, uncooked
- 11 oz pack of Peanut Butter Chips
Cooking Guide
-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
- Mix together the butter and sugars in a large bowl until creamy.
- Beat in eggs and vanilla until well combined.
- In a separate bowl, sift together flour, baking soda, and salt.
- Add flour mixture to butter mixture and electric mix both together well.
- Add in oats and peanut butter chips and stir.
- Use about 1 tbspful of dough for each cookie.
- Bake on an ungreased cookie sheet for 9 minutes.
- Cool on wire rack.
